Новая версия программы:
ver 2.00.00 (06.03.2014)
  • Криптованный протокол обмена с сервером
ВНИМАНИЕ !!! Версия не совместима с предыдущей и обязательна к переустановке

---------- Добавлено 25.03.2014 в 19:04 ---------- Предыдущее сообщение 06.03.2014 было в 20:32 ----------

Новая версия программы:

ver 2.00.01 (26.03.2014)
  • Изменил алгоритм проверки работоспособности сервиса
  • Нажатие на Кнопку состояния сервиса при работающем сервисе теперь останаливает сервис
  • редизайн окна "Настройки"
  • "Главное окно" - лрбавил поле "Метод" - показывающий метод определения координат. Старое поле используется только для визуализации доступных провайдеров сервиса.
  • БАГИ:
    - подправил работу по принятию на запись точки, локация которой определена по GSM
    - подправил получение первой точки по GPS для интервальных георежимов


---------- Добавлено 04.04.2014 в 10:06 ---------- Предыдущее сообщение 25.03.2014 было в 20:04 ----------

Новая версия программы:

ver 2.00.02 (04.04.2014)
  • Редизайн основного окна для работы с малыми разрешениями (240x240) (встроил скроллинг)
  • Подправил получение тайлов для GoogleSat


---------- Добавлено 18.04.2014 в 11:59 ---------- Предыдущее сообщение 04.04.2014 было в 10:06 ----------

Новая версия программы:

ver 2.00.03 (18.04.2014)
  • Заметил одну неприятность: даже при более-менее работающем GPS бывает, что передаются короткие последовательности из точек по GSM, что негативно сказывается на истинности траектории трека.
    Фильтрую такие последовательности.
  • Закрытие tcp сокета вне зависимости от наличия ответа сервера.
  • При формировании путевой точки беру системный timestamp.


---------- Добавлено 25.04.2014 в 17:52 ---------- Предыдущее сообщение 18.04.2014 было в 11:59 ----------

Новая версия программы:

ver 2.00.04 (25.04.2014)
  • Десятиминутный/часовой георежим получал точку от GPS в течении минуты/пяти минут соответственно. Добавил указание выбора, при котором ждем пока не получим GPS точку. Кликните по одному из этих георежимов - получите диалог выбора.
  • Значёк работающего сервиса в уведомлениях с отображением информации о работе сервиса.
  • Подправил незасыпание для режимов 10 минут / 1 час


---------- Добавлено 07.05.2014 в 16:49 ---------- Предыдущее сообщение 25.04.2014 было в 17:52 ----------

Новая версия программы ver 2.01.00 (07.05.2014)
  • Уменьшил энергопотребление для значка сервиса в панели уведомлений
  • Оптимизировал загрузку тайлов карт
  • Для спутниковых карт добавил слой с дорогами
  • Ликвидация проблемы с нулевым imei'ем
  • Фильтрую точку, если предыдущая GPS точка внутри круга точности GSM точки


---------- Добавлено 29.05.2014 в 17:24 ---------- Предыдущее сообщение 07.05.2014 было в 16:49 ----------

ver 2.01.01 (29.05.2014)
  • Убрал из настроек чекер "Не засыпать" незасыпание реализовано иным способом чем раньше и отключать его нет ни смысла ни надобности
  • Установил динамический таймаут на прием UDP пакетов при отсутствии сети таймаут увеличиваю (для экономии батареи)
  • В десятиминутном и часовом режимах пропускаю первые точки - они с низкой точностью
  • БАГ: ошибка программы при удалении значений с полей формы "НАСТРОЙКИ"
  • Встроен алгоритм ликвидации звезд (блуждание координат при статическом положении устройства).
    Алгоритм активируется только при нулевой скорости, полученной от GPS приемника.


---------- Добавлено 07.06.2014 в 09:38 ---------- Предыдущее сообщение 29.05.2014 было в 17:24 ----------

Новая версия программы
ver 2.02.00
  • Устранил избыточное чтение базы данных при просчёте количества точек в кеше
  • Аудио прослушивание трекеров Сообщества
  • БАГ: при получении от сервера битого пакета о подтверждении получения маршрутной точки падал маханизм приема UDP пакетов.
    Это выражалось в постоянном увеличении точек в кеше, хотя на трек это не влияло ибо точки сервером принимались
  • На некоторых планшетах, в полноэкранном режиме карты, скрывается экранная панель "аппаратных" клавиш Back, Home, ... что приводит к невозможности выхода из окна карты.
    Добавил кнопку Back в список трекеров (нижняя левая кнопка со стрелкой в окне карты)


---------- Добавлено 13.06.2014 в 09:24 ---------- Предыдущее сообщение 07.06.2014 было в 09:38 ----------

ver 2.03.00 (13.06.2014)
  • Телеметрия (датчики/события)
    - заряд батареи
    - температура батареи
    - статус "Батарея заряжается"
    - событие начала работы сервиса
    - событие соединения с интернет
  • На некоторых устройствах нет IMEI и нет номера SIM. Для таких устройств беру уникальный номер MAC Wifi


---------- Добавлено 20.06.2014 в 09:08 ---------- Предыдущее сообщение 13.06.2014 было в 09:24 ----------

ver 2.03.01 (20.06.2014)
  • Автопереключение в стандартный режим, из десятиминутного или часового, при подключении к внешнему источнику питания.
  • Событие подключения/отключения зарядного/usb устройства
  • В десятиминутном/часовом режимах с опцией "До Получния", возможен вариант, при котором для плохого GPS сигнала точку вообще не возможно будет получить. А передать что-то надо.
    На последней интервальной десятине (10-ая минута для десятиминутного, 55-ая минута для часового) включаю определение по GSM.


---------- Добавлено 27.06.2014 в 11:18 ---------- Предыдущее сообщение 20.06.2014 было в 09:08 ----------

Новая версия программы ver 2.03.02 (27.06.2014)
  • Отключаю алгоритм ликвидации звезд при выключенном GPS
  • БАГ: На карте, при рисовании жёлтого следа(это след от последней переданной на сервер точки до текущего местоположения) при включенном GPS пропускаю случайно-проскакиваемые GSM точки
  • Событие отключения от интернет
  • Передаю внеочередные точки при возникновении событий "соединения/отключения интернет", "подключения/отключения зарядного/usb устройства"
  • Прогресбар для длительных операций (в Сообществах и в Настройках)


---------- Добавлено 21.07.2014 в 11:00 ---------- Предыдущее сообщение 27.06.2014 было в 11:18 ----------

Новая версия ver 3.00.00 (21.07.2014)
(Версия не совместима с предыдущей и обязательна к переустановке ! Все предыдущие версии более не работают с сервером.)
  • Клик на уведомлении о работающем сервисе запускает программу
  • В списке трекеров сообщества добавил кнопку запуска "Прослушивания"
  • Оптимизировал чтение базы данных кешируемых точек
  • Отправка запроса на прослушивание посредством SMS
  • Получение координат трекеров Сообщества посредством SMS


---------- Добавлено 08.08.2014 в 11:19 ---------- Предыдущее сообщение 21.07.2014 было в 11:00 ----------

Новая версия программы: ver 3.00.01 (08.08.2014)
  • БАГ: При медленном инет-соединении, при определении местоположении удалённого устройства посредством СМС,
    для случая невозможности определения своих координат самим удалённым устройством (геолокационный запрос идет с телефона наблюдателя),
    происходит падение сервиса, с последующим его перезапуском.
    ИСПРАВИЛ падение.


---------- Добавлено 15.08.2014 в 10:10 ---------- Предыдущее сообщение 08.08.2014 было в 11:19 ----------

Новая версия программы ver 3.01.00 (15.05.2014)
  • В атрибутах геоинформации по трекеру (влсьмой скрин на сайте) добавил информацию
    о заряде батареи и статусе (заряжается/не заряжается)
  • Использование сервиса unwiredlabs.com для получение координат трекеров Сообщества
    при условии что сам удаленный трекер не может определить свое местоположение.
    Ознакомтесь, пожалуйста, с документацией


---------- Добавлено 22.08.2014 в 18:49 ---------- Предыдущее сообщение 15.08.2014 было в 10:10 ----------

Новая версия программы ver 3.02.00 (22.08.2014)

---------- Добавлено 09.09.2014 в 10:07 ---------- Предыдущее сообщение 22.08.2014 было в 18:49 ----------

Новая версия программы ver 3.02.01 (09.09.2014)
  • На некоторых устройствах не срабатывала вибрация при получении координат по SMS
  • Подправил алгоритм получения SMS


---------- Добавлено 03.10.2014 в 11:26 ---------- Предыдущее сообщение 09.09.2014 было в 10:07 ----------

ver 3.03.00 (03.10.2014)
  • Работа сервиса без значка уведомления в Трее
  • Новые георежимы: минутный, трёх-минутный
    Ознакомтесь, пожалуйста, с документацией
  • Полностью переработан алгоритм работы в георежимах.
    Для всех георежимов введено событие отключения GPS при
    критических значениях видимых/используемых спутников. (Отключение при плохом GPS сигнале)
  • Проведены новые тесты энергопотребления для всех георежимов.
    Опубликованы результаты тестов и графики энергопотребления.
  • Визуализация информации о видимых спутниках
  • Введён алгоритм анализа качества сигнала спутников. Задачей которого является
    отключение GPS для экономии батареи в местах со слабым сигналом, и включение
    GPS при улучшении сигналов до приемлемого уровня.